Taxonomic Classification

Rank Chiriquinan Serotine hedgehog
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um same Chordata (Chordates) Chordata (Chordates)
Class same Mammalia (Mammals) Mammalia (Mammals)
Order Chiroptera (Bats) Erinaceomorpha (Erinaceomorpha)
Family Vespertilionidae Erinaceidae
Genus Eptesicus Erinaceus
Species Eptesicus chiriquinus Erinaceus europaeus

Evolutionary Relationship

Chiriquinan Serotine and hedgehog share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(Mammals)

Chiriquinan Serotine

The Chiriquinan Serotine (Eptesicus chiriquinus) is a species in the genus Eptesicus. It is currently classified as Least Concern on the IUCN Red List. Distributed across Colombia, Ecuador, and Venezuela.

hedgehog

hedgehog (Erinaceus europaeus) is classified as Least Concern (LC) on the IUCN Red List. Widespread and abundant across its range, with stable populations and no immediate conservation concerns.
